用途 | 正则表达式 |
---|---|
邮箱 | ^[\w-]+(\.[\w-]+)*@[\w-]+(\.[\w-]+)+$ |
手机号码 | ^1[3-9]\d{9}$ |
中文字符 | [\u4e00-\u9fa5] |
URL | ^https?:\/\/[\w\-]+(\.[\w\-]+)+([\w\-\.,@?^=%&:\/~\+#]*[\w\-\@?^=%&\/~\+#])?$ |
符号 | 说明 |
---|---|
. | 匹配除换行符外的任意字符 |
^ | 匹配字符串开始位置 |
$ | 匹配字符串结束位置 |
* | 匹配前面的子表达式零次或多次 |
+ | 匹配前面的子表达式一次或多次 |
? | 匹配前面的子表达式零次或一次 |
\d | 匹配数字 |
\w | 匹配字母、数字、下划线 |